Why is everybody in Terra Inc??? :confused:

No one is in Terra Inc. Character location is determined not by province but by the court/country. It is displayed in the TAG colum in CKL in the form Court_Name[Court_TAG].
In earlier versions of the game (1.00 and 1.01 IIRC) there was an attribute called 'home' in saved character data. This was probably the province ID, which determined where has the character return to, if its current court is destroyed but I am not sure about it. In newer versions the character migration is ruled by its family ties and this is probably the reason why there are no more 'home' attributes in savefile. Therefore default value 0 representing 'terra incognita' is used. So it is no bug, but an obsolete feature.
